Polyphase permanent magnet synchronous motor current waveform optimal control method

ActiveCN103490692AEffective amplitudeEffective Phase Gain ControlElectronic commutation motor controlVector control systemsControl vectorElectric machine
The invention discloses a polyphase permanent magnet synchronous motor current waveform optimal control method, comprising the following steps of A, current reference value coordinate transformation; B, current multiple proportion resonance regulation; and C, coupling compensation. In the control method, based on polyphase permanent magnet synchronous motor vector control, a polyphase synchronous rotating coordinate system current reference value is transformed to a current reference value of each phase in a polyphase static coordinate system through polyphase coordinate transformation, the current reference value of each phase and a current feedback value of each phase of a motor are respectively subjected to improved multiple superposition proportion resonance regulation, and a resonance separation method is introduced, decoupling is realized by feed-forward compensation, and floating tracking and harmful subharmonic restraining for highly dynamic property fundamental waves and usable subharmonic are realized. The method can restrain the adverse impacts, such as motor loss, torque ripple and vibration noise, caused by a harmful harmonic current of the polyphase motor, can explore the positive effects of the usable harmonic current, gives full play to the advantages of the polyphase motor and improves the system performance.

Polyphase induction motor appointed secondary current waveform control method

The invention relates to a polyphase induction motor appointed secondary current waveform control method, comprising the following steps of A, current feedback value processing; B, current complex regulation; and C, voltage reference value determination. In the method, based on polyphase induction motor vector control, a polyphase motor current is mapped to a synchronous rotating coordinate system of mutually orthogonal fundamental waves and each usable subharmonic through polyphase synchronous rotating coordinate transformation, proportion integration resonance regulation and proportion integration regulation are respectively executed, and a complete current controller is formed by superposition; integration and resonance separation are respectively introduced so as to further improve the static and dynamic performances. The method has the advantages that the method is realized by digital control, and is simple and practical; the method can restrain the adverse impacts, such as motor loss, torque ripple and vibration noise, caused by a harmful harmonic current of the polyphase induction motor, can explore the positive effects of the usable harmonic, and gives full play to the advantages of the polyphase motor. The method can be used in the high-power alternating current motor driving occasions, such as marine propulsion, mining machinery and track hauling.

Accumulated water treatment device of steaming and baking oven, steaming and baking oven and control method

The invention discloses an accumulated water treatment device of a steaming and baking oven, the steaming and baking oven and a control method. The steaming and baking oven is provided with a cavity used for accommodating articles to be heated. The accumulated water treatment device comprises a heating device; and the heating device heats the bottom of the cavity to perform accumulated water treatment, and controls the on/off state of the accumulated water treatment device according to the detected temperature of the bottom of the cavity so as to perform/stop the accumulated water treatment inthe cavity. The accumulated water treatment device can timely remove accumulated water in the cavity, and can avoid the environment pollution in the cavity of the steaming and baking oven due to bacterium breeding in the accumulated water, so that the work environment in the baking oven is more sanitary. The accumulated water treatment device has the advantages that the cavity bottom deformationand color change cannot be caused in the accumulated water treatment process; meanwhile, the temperature lowering characteristics of the accumulated water are used; the temperature is used for controlling the on/off state of the accumulated water treatment device; the accumulated water treatment process is effectively controlled; the timely treatment on the accumulated water is realized; and the equipment damage or danger due to too high heating temperature is avoided.

Control method for assisting primary frequency modulation of thermal power generating unit by flywheel energy storage

The invention discloses a control method for assisting primary frequency modulation of a thermal power generating unit by flywheel energy storage, and relates to the technical field of thermal power generating unit control. By means of the load characteristic of flywheel energy storage, when frequency modulation load reduction is needed in power grid frequency modulation, a motor in a flywheel energy storage system serves as a motor to accelerate a flywheel by means of the quick charging function of the flywheel energy storage when frequency modulation load reduction is needed; electric energy is converted into mechanical energy, so that the unit load is reduced; when power grid frequency modulation needs to increase load, the motor in the flywheel energy storage system is used as a generator to convert mechanical energy of a flywheel into electric energy to supply power to the outside by utilizing a quick discharge function of flywheel energy storage, so that unit load is increased; and therefore, the primary frequency modulation performance of the unit can directly and automatically adjust the steam turbine control valve to complete the primary frequency modulation response without depending on the self-adjusting system of the steam turbine, the service life of steam turbine generator unit equipment is prolonged, and the economical efficiency of a thermal generator unit is enhanced.

Loop closing control method for loop closing switch of power distribution network

The present invention relates to a loop closing control method for the loop closing switch of a power distribution network. The output power of the distributed power generation on at least one side of the loop closing switch is adjusted, and the access power of a load on at least one side of the loop closing switch is switched and adjusted. Finally, the voltage vector difference between the two sides of the loop closing switch is enabled to be smaller than a preset value. Meanwhile, the voltages of other related nodes, other than the loop closing switch of the power distribution network, are within the range of allowable values. At this time, the loop closing switch is closed. When the loop closing control cannot be realized through the adjustment of one parameter, the other parameter is adjusted to finally realize the loop closing control. Therefore, the control method is very efficient. The distributed power generation has the advantage of reactive compensation, and the flexible adjustment of loads is also realized. Therefore, the loop closing success rate of the loop closing switch of the power distribution network is improved, so that the uninterrupted power supply to important loads is realized. Meanwhile, the investment on traditional power generation power requirements and other reactive power compensation equipment is reduced.

Intelligent buoyancy type flood control and water retaining device for ventilation pavilion and control method

The invention discloses an intelligent buoyancy type flood control and water retaining device for a ventilation pavilion and a control method. The device comprises a water retaining plate, a shell, a buoyancy assembly, an on-site monitoring system and an electrical control unit. The overall structure of the water baffle is matched with the shape of the ventilation pavilion, and the water baffle is formed by splicing a plurality of water baffles. The shell accommodates the buoyancy assembly and the water baffle, a water inlet hole is formed in the bottom, an extending opening is formed in the top, and a sealing tape is arranged between the extending opening and the baffle. The buoyancy assembly comprises a buoyancy device and a guide device. The buoyancy device drives the water baffle to float upwards. The guiding device is used for guiding the buoyancy device. The on-site monitoring system collects water level information and water baffle state information at the corresponding position of a position sensor in real time through a water level gauge and the position sensor, and transmits the information to the electrical control unit. Compared with preset parameters, judging and displaying are performed. The flood prevention capacity of the ventilation pavilion in rainstorm is improved, the station is prevented from being flooded, and subway operation safety is ensured. The automation degree of monitoring is improved, the speed is high, and the efficiency is high.

Unmanned aerial vehicle anti-collision control method

The present invention relates to an unmanned aerial vehicle anti-collision control method. The method comprises the steps of: determining a control area of a host; allowing unmanned aerial vehicles inthe area to receive control of a host device, each unmanned aerial vehicle comprises identity information, route information and route calculation complexity information; when the unmanned aerial vehicles detect there is another unmanned aerial vehicle in a certain range at the positions where the unmanned aerial vehicles are located, sending the identity information, the route information and the route calculation complexity information to the host device; and when the unmanned aerial vehicles receive the replanning route information sent by the host device, executing the flight motion at the next position. The unmanned aerial vehicle anti-collision control method employs the host to calculate and command a new flight route and performs centralized control to avoid generation of danger of collision of unmanned aerial vehicles. Or the unmanned aerial vehicle anti-collision control method allows the unmanned aerial vehicles to directly send their own next routes and the route calculation complexities to one another and allow the unmanned aerial vehicles to respectively combine the received opposite-side routes and their own routes for determination to avoid collision. The whole control method is good in implementation effect in a complex environment.

Thermal power plant 0 class load power supply system and control method

The invention discloses a thermal power plant 0 class load power supply system and control method. The system comprises an energy storage device, an AC uninterrupted power load low-voltage power distribution device, an AC security load low-voltage power distribution device, and a DC security load DC power distribution device. The AC uninterrupted power load low-voltage power distribution device, the AC security load low-voltage power distribution device and the DC security load DC power distribution device are internally provided with an AC uninterrupted power load bus, an AC security load busand a DC security load bus respectively. The energy storage device is connected to the AC uninterrupted power load bus, the AC security load bus and the DC security load bus through a first switch, asecond switch and a third switch. The AC uninterrupted power load bus is also connected to a first power supply for a thermal power plant power through a fourth switch, and the AC security load bus is also connected to a second power supply for the thermal power plant power through a fifth switch. The system is intensively streamlined, compared with a conventional method, fully static equipment improves the reliability of a 0 class load power supply of the thermal power plant, the power supply quality is improved, and pollutant emissions are reduced.
